For this week's eng sync: every ScanBridge artifact that ships to the Halloway warehouse fleet must carry verifiable provenance. Builds run only on the Ferngate hermetic runners; the attestation records source revision, toolchain digest, and the signing identity of the Pellucid release key. Do not accept side-loaded scanner firmware, even for hotfixes — rebuild through the pipeline instead. Auditors cross-check each attestation weekly. The provenance token for the current release candidate is listed below.

trace token, fafog-kageg: htk4_98e6

Handover note — Crumbwheel order cutoffs.

Welcome aboard. The bakery cutoff rule in Crumbwheel closes same-day orders at 14:00 local to each storefront, not UTC — this has bitten us twice. Holiday overrides live in the calendar service and take precedence silently, so always check there first when a cutoff looks wrong. To unlock the calendar service's admin console after a restart, enter the recovery passphrase below.

vault phrase of bagap-bahaf = silion-pelox-sorox-casdor-quenwyn-fraax-eliox-praael-kelion-quenvan-kasox-rusael-norius-belvan

Handover note — FareForge rules engine (from Dalia to Renn, shared for new joiners)

FareForge evaluates shipping-fee rules in priority order; the first matching rule wins, so never reorder the zone rules without rerunning the golden-path suite. Surcharge rules stack, base rates do not. The Kestrelport staging instance mirrors production rules nightly, so test there first. Rule edits require a dry-run diff before merge. The current service configuration values are listed below for reference.

settings of taguf-fajef:
[eliath]
team = julir
access_code = ac_78465c
host = eliath.lumicgrid.local
port = 8443
owner = feniel.wenir
peer = quenmir.tolvaqsys.local

TICKET LT-providers: Tailgrep CLI v0.9 adds a stable plugin hook for custom log formatters. Breaking: `--follow` now defaults to structured output; plugins parsing raw lines must declare `format: raw` in their manifest. Deadline for migration: next minor release. Plugin authors should test against the staging stream on the Harkwell cluster. Docs updated in the external portal. This ticket cannot ship until sign-off is recorded. Sign-off authority rests with the maintainer listed below.

account owner for bawip-tahag: Raleth Quenok